Hamburg-Fuhlsbuttel vs Erlian Climate & Distance Between

China flag
  • The distance between Hamburg-Fuhlsbuttel, Germany and Erlian, China is approximately 6,915 km or 4,297 mi.
  • To reach Hamburg-Fuhlsbuttel in this distance one would set out from Erlian bearing 319°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Hamburg-Fuhlsbuttel bearing 233.1° or SW .
  • Hamburg-Fuhlsbuttel has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Erlian has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
  • Hamburg-Fuhlsbuttel is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Erlian is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 5.1 °C (9.1°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 25.2 °C (45.4°F) less in Hamburg-Fuhlsbuttel.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 628.5 mm (24.7 in) more which is equivalent to 628.5 l/m² (15.42 US gal/ft²) or 6,285,000 l/ha (671,908 US gal/ac) more. About 5 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10° lower in Hamburg-Fuhlsbuttel than in Erlian.
